Facilities Maintenance Operative

Location: Knights Park, KT1 2QJ

Salary: Β£34,140 per annum + Excellent Benefits!

Contract: Full-time, Permanent

Hours: 37 per week, Monday-Friday

Kingston University Services Company (KUSCO) provides a comprehensive repair and maintenance service across Kingston University sites, helping to ensure the smooth running of our campuses, facilities, and equipment.

We\’re looking for a Facilities Maintenance Operative to join our team at Knights Park.

This is a varied role where no two days are the same – you\’ll be involved in everything from planned maintenance to urgent repairs, as well as supporting campus activities and events.

What you\’ll be doing

  • Carrying out planned preventive maintenance (PPMs) and regular building inspections.
  • Responding to reactive maintenance issues, such as plumbing, electrical, and minor repair works.
  • Fixing and maintaining facilities (e.g., lamp changes, unblocking sinks/toilets, fixing taps, minor carpentry, painting, decorating).
  • Using mechanical knowledge to troubleshoot systems, interpret building drawings, and support technical issues.
  • Managing equipment, tools, and stock relevant to your role.
  • Providing monthly maintenance reports and meeting with your supervisor for updates.
  • Delivering excellent customer service to students and staff.
  • You\’ll also occasionally support non-maintenance activities (training provided), such as:
  • Assisting with fire alarm response and investigations.
  • Locking and unlocking buildings.
  • Supporting the Knights Park Flood Defence Team.
  • Helping with campus events, exhibitions, and degree shows.

What we\’re looking for

  • Proven experience in general maintenance or as a semi-skilled tradesperson.
  • A broad knowledge of building maintenance and engineering services.
  • Hands-on skills in carpentry, plumbing, painting, and general repairs.
  • Experience completing PPMs and handling reactive maintenance.
  • Confidence working with portable tools, small plant, ladders, and equipment.
  • Health & Safety awareness, with the ability to work safely at heights.
  • Good IT skills, able to use facility management systems and mobile devices.
  • Strong communication skills – both written and verbal.
  • A flexible, team-oriented approach with the ability to work independently when needed.

It\’s essential that you have:
Full UK driving licence

It would be great if you had:
IOSH qualification
Knowledge of permit-to-work systems
Experience in a commercial or campus environment
